Schneider Electric C65H-DCC10A Multi9 C65H DC Miniature Circuit Breaker

The Schneider Electric C65H-DCC10A, also cataloged as the C65H-DCC10A Miniature Circuit Breaker, operates as a dedicated hardware component for overcurrent protection within Multi9 C65H DC platform networks. Configured for direct current electrical execution, this 2-pole device intercepts overload and short-circuit faults to safeguard downstream components.

Overcurrent Protection and Deterministic Network Isolation

The electrical execution of the C65H-DCC10A utilizes a 2-pole configuration to break both polarity paths of the direct current loop simultaneously. The built-in D-curve tripping characteristic permits high transient inrush current spikes without initiating nuisance tripping cycles. Because this isolation mechanism is entirely mechanical and thermal, it achieves fault clearance independent of backplane bus communication velocity or active control processor states, preventing inductive fault energy from feeding back into adjacent deterministic network devices.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How does the D-curve tripping threshold differ from a standard C-curve in DC applications?

A: The D-curve profile is engineered for higher magnetic tripping thresholds to tolerate magnetic inrush currents from inductive field loads, preventing premature circuit interruption during motor startup sequences.

Q: Is this DC circuit breaker restricted to specific wire types for field termination?

A: The screw clamp terminals accommodate both solid and stranded copper conductors within the 1.5...25 mm2 range, provided standard industrial terminal preparation guidelines are followed.

Field Installation Guidelines

  • Secure the circuit breaker chassis onto a standard 35 mm symmetrical DIN rail inside a protective industrial enclosure.
  • Observe the directional polarity markings molded onto the device frame to ensure proper arc-chute operation during high-current interruption events.
  • Tighten the integrated screw clamp terminals using calibrated hand tools to maintain constant tension over the 1.5...25 mm2 field wiring.
  • Maintain physical clearance from adjacent high-heat dissipation sources inside the panel enclosure to prevent shifts in the thermal trip calibration curve.
